摘要
Purpose: To determine whether intracameral moxifloxacin 500 mu g is noninferior to 250 mu g for central endothelial cell loss (ECL) after phacoemulsification. Setting: Aravind Eye Care System. Design: Prospective masked randomized study. Methods: Eyes with bilateral nuclear cataracts, central endothelial cell density (ECD) of more than 2000 cells/mm(2), and ECD not differing between eyes by more than 200 cells/mm(2) underwent phacoemulsification at least 14 days apart. Intraoperatively, the first eye was randomized to receive either a 500 or 250 mu g dose of moxifloxacin intracamerally and received the other dose for the second-eye surgery. Postoperative course was monitored at 1 day, 1 week, 1 month, and 3 months. Preoperative and 30-day and 90-day postoperative central ECD was determined by a reading center for a masked analysis of ECL at 3 months postoperatively. Results: Fifty eyes of 25 patients (aged 48 to 69 years) underwent uneventful surgery and had normal postoperative courses. The point estimate (PE) and 95% CI for the mean difference in % ECL between the 500 mu g and 250 mu g doses at 3 months postoperatively was 0.8% (-5.8%, 7.4%). Upon identifying and removing 2 outliers, noninferiority was proven with a mean difference of the PE, -2.2% (CI, -6.5%, 2.1%). Conclusions: Clinical and corneal endothelial cell were comparable in this study population for the 250 mu g and 500 mu g doses of intracameral moxifloxacin. Both doses were well tolerated clinically, supporting the use of the higher dose for improved antimicrobial coverage for the prevention of postoperative endophthalmitis.
